[Rcpp-commits] r2526 - pkg/Rcpp/inst/doc/Rcpp-modules

noreply at r-forge.r-project.org noreply at r-forge.r-project.org
Fri Nov 26 10:49:11 CET 2010


Author: romain
Date: 2010-11-26 10:49:11 +0100 (Fri, 26 Nov 2010)
New Revision: 2526

Modified:
   pkg/Rcpp/inst/doc/Rcpp-modules/Rcpp-modules.Rnw
Log:
s/width/range

Modified: pkg/Rcpp/inst/doc/Rcpp-modules/Rcpp-modules.Rnw
===================================================================
--- pkg/Rcpp/inst/doc/Rcpp-modules/Rcpp-modules.Rnw	2010-11-25 16:07:39 UTC (rev 2525)
+++ pkg/Rcpp/inst/doc/Rcpp-modules/Rcpp-modules.Rnw	2010-11-26 09:49:11 UTC (rev 2526)
@@ -427,8 +427,6 @@
 A class is exposed using the \texttt{class\_} class. The \texttt{World}
 class may be exposed to \proglang{R} :
 
-%% [Dirk:] should 'width' be 'range' ?
-
 <<lang=cpp>>=
 using namespace Rcpp ;
 class Uniform {
@@ -443,7 +441,7 @@
     double min, max ;
 };
 
-double width( Uniform* w){
+double range( Uniform* w){
 	return w->max - w->min ;
 }
 
@@ -457,7 +455,7 @@
         .field( "max", &Uniform::max )
 
         .method( "draw", &World::draw )
-        .method( "width", &width )
+        .method( "range", &range )
 	;
 
 }
@@ -478,7 +476,7 @@
     double min, max ;
 };
 
-double width( Uniform* w){
+double range( Uniform* w){
 	return w->max - w->min ;
 }
 
@@ -492,7 +490,7 @@
 	    .field( "max", &Uniform::max )
 
 		.method( "draw", &Uniform::draw )
-		.method( "width", &width )
+		.method( "range", &range )
 	;
 
 }
@@ -503,9 +501,9 @@
 Uniform <- unif_module$Uniform
 u <- new( Uniform, 0, 10 )
 u$draw( 10L )
-u$width()
+u$range()
 u$max <- 1
-u$width()
+u$range()
 u$draw( 10 )
 @
 



More information about the Rcpp-commits mailing list